Study of the Wing and Tail Aerodynamic Interference in Wind Tunnel Test to a Upper Wing Layout Light Aircraft

  • In order to explore the situation of light aircraft wing and tail aerodynamic interference, and acquire the aerodynamic characteristics of the horizontal tail height position in two cases, this paper studied the aerodynamic characteristics and effect with high and low layout of the horizontal tail wing in different wind speed and angle of attack. The research results show that in normal flight attitude,the wing wake flow interference that the high horizontal tail accepts is relatively small than the low one,that the high horizontal tail aerodynamic efficiency is relatively high and that the whole performance is more fine. This test results can be used for light aircraft design reference.
